littlebot
Published on 2025-04-11 / 1 Visits
0

【源码】基于C语言的数据结构与算法练习集

项目简介

本项目是基于C语言的数据结构与算法练习集,借助实现各类经典数据结构和算法来增强编程能力。项目代码涉及链表、栈、树、队列等数据结构,以及排序、搜索、计算幂集等算法。代码源自《数据结构与算法分析--C语言描述》《算法导论》第三版、《深入理解计算机操作系统》第二版等经典技术书籍。

项目的主要特性和功能

  • 数据结构实现:实现了链表、栈、树、队列等常见数据结构。
  • 算法实现:包含排序、搜索、计算幂集等经典算法。
  • 编程基础展示:呈现了处理命令行参数、错误处理、内存管理等关键编程概念。
  • 实际问题解决:利用数据结构和算法解决排序、搜索等具体问题。
  • 代码分析:部分代码分析可在我的博客中找到详细解释。

安装使用步骤

  1. 下载源码:用户已下载本项目的源码文件。
  2. 编译代码:使用C语言编译器(如GCC)编译源码文件。 bash gcc -o output_file source_file.c
  3. 运行程序:执行生成的可执行文件。 bash ./output_file
  4. 查看结果:根据程序提示,查看数据结构和算法的运行结果。

通过以上步骤,用户可以运行并测试项目中的各种数据结构和算法实现。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】